1. Santa’s Workshop Entrance

Transform your door into a life-sized entryway to the North Pole.
Use red paper for the base, gold “metal” details around the frame, and add tiny cut-out elves peeking through. A “WORKSHOP HOURS: 24/7” sign adds the finishing touch.

Pro tip: Add fairy lights around the edges for an instant wow factor.
2. The Fireplace Door

Turn your door into a cozy Christmas fireplace scene.
Layer brick-print paper, add stockings with real names on them, and glue cotton at the top to mimic smoke.
Bonus: Stick a “DO NOT OPEN UNTIL DECEMBER 25TH” tag above the handle.
3. The “Snowed In” Door

Cover your entire door with white fluffy fabric and silver glitter to make it look like it’s buried in snow.
Add a frosted window scene with a peek of a Christmas tree inside.
Perfect for: Offices or classrooms that want a minimalist but magical look.
4. Elf Surveillance HQ

A hilarious idea for classrooms or team offices.
Make the door look like a command center with printed “ELF CAM” signs, blinking fairy lights, and a clipboard that says “NAUGHTY LIST: UNDER REVIEW.”
Add-on: A little elf figure holding a walkie-talkie for extra laughs.
5. Gingerbread Bakery Door

Use brown paper for the base, white icing-style borders, and colorful paper “candies” around the frame.
Add a sign that reads: “GINGER’S BAKERY — Fresh Cookies Daily.”
Pro tip: Glue on real candy canes for a 3D finish (just warn people not to eat them!).
6. Winter Wonderland Forest

Turn your door into a snowy pine forest with layered paper trees, cotton snowbanks, and a soft gradient blue background.
Use a few fairy lights or LED candles at the base for cozy glow.
Best for: Classrooms or front doors where you can go big on detail.
7. “Reindeer Parking Only” Door

Paint or wrap your door in a deep red background and add cut-out parking signs that say “Reserved for Dasher, Dancer, and Rudolph.”
Add footprints leading up to the door and a sleigh peeking from the side.
Humorous detail: A small “VIOLATORS WILL BE TOWED TO THE NORTH POLE” sign.
8. The “Grinch Zone”

Go bold with a lime green background and oversized Grinch face taking over the door.

Add a mischievous hand stealing an ornament or gift from the side.
Optional: Tape a mini sign that says “NO CHEER ALLOWED” for comic effect.
9. Christmas Movie Marathon Door

Perfect for pop culture fans!
Design your door like a TV screen showing holiday favorites — Home Alone, Elf, The Polar Express, and The Grinch.
Extra points: Print little movie posters to stick around the frame like a cinema wall.
10. “Tinsel Trauma” Door

For a funny, chaotic take — make your door look like it’s been attacked by Christmas decorations.
Tangled tinsel, half-hanging baubles, a drooping wreath, and a “SEND HELP” sign in bold red text.
Viral-level detail: Stick an elf halfway through the chaos like it’s given up mid-decorating.

Quick Checklist for Contest Success
✅ Choose a clear, bold theme
✅ Use at least one 3D or interactive element
✅ Add lighting (fairy lights or LED strips)
✅ Include text that pops — funny or festive
✅ Keep it neat and photographable
